We think the answer is "BURLESQUE" which means:
- adjective
- • Relating to or characteristic of a burlesque noun
- • A theatrical entertainment of broad and earthy humor; consists of comic skits and short turns (and sometimes striptease)
- • A composition that imitates or misrepresents somebody's style, usually in a humorous way verb
- • Make a parody of
